§ 36-26-16 — Qualifications for social work associate.

South Dakota·Title 36 PROFESSIONS AND OCCUPATIONS·Ch. 36-23 SOCIAL WORKERS

The board shall issue a license as a "social work associate" to an applicant who:

(1)Has a baccalaureate degree in a nonsocial work field or discipline or an associate of arts degree in the human services in a program approved by the board from a junior college, college, or university approved by the board or equivalent as determined by the board;
(2)Has passed an examination prepared by the board for this purpose.
